From: SourceForge.net <no...@so...> - 2004-11-26 19:08:28
|
Bugs item #1051950, was opened at 2004-10-22 06:19 Message generated for change (Comment added) made by drieseng You can respond by visiting: https://sourceforge.net/tracker/?func=detail&atid=474851&aid=1051950&group_id=54790 Category: None Group: None >Status: Closed >Resolution: Fixed Priority: 5 Submitted By: Nick Zigomanis (nzig) >Assigned to: Gert Driesen (drieseng) Summary: Comregister task in 20041006 nightlybuild locks files Initial Comment: The comregister task upon registering a typelibrary, prevents further manipulation of that file, eg, recreating it, deleting it, renaming it, etc. It's seems to be locking the file from further manipulation. I suspect the same is true when unregistering. The problem can be demonstarted with the simple buildfile: <project> <target name="test"> <comregister file="typelib.tlb" /> <delete file="typelib.tlb" /> </target> </project> Running nant test, produces, test: [comregister] Registering 1 files [delete] Deleting file B:\eBS\typelib.tlb. BUILD FAILED B:\eBS\test.build(6,4): Cannot delete file 'B:\eBS\typelib.tlb'. Access to the path "B:\eBS\typelib.tlb" is denied. Total time: 0.3 seconds. ---------------------------------------------------------------------- >Comment By: Gert Driesen (drieseng) Date: 2004-11-26 20:08 Message: Logged In: YES user_id=707851 This is now fixed in cvs. Thanks for the report ! ---------------------------------------------------------------------- You can respond by visiting: https://sourceforge.net/tracker/?func=detail&atid=474851&aid=1051950&group_id=54790 |